The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ood is rolling out the red carpet for poker players over the next two weeks. The World Poker Tour brings three highlight events to the property and in conjunction with the championship events are a $50,000 Super High Roller, a $25,500 High Roller and the Jason Taylor WPT Foundation Charity event.

The two high roller events both feature a $1 million guarantee, combined with the two championship events, tips the scales to $6 million locked up for players across four tournaments.

Players not in the SHR stratosphere have $500,000 in guarantees in preliminary events leading up to the $3,500 Seminole Hard Rock Poker Showdown. Sunday, March 26th sees a $1,650 Purple Chip Bounty event at 3 pm with a $100,000 prize pool and two $570 events run on Monday and Tuesday, each with $50,000 guaranteed.

The $10,000 SHR Finale and the $15,000 WPT Tournament of Champions headline the second week of action, with two more TOC seats up for grabs in the WPT title events. 

Miami Dolphins legend Jason Taylor’s Foundation returns for the second year to benefit South Florida’s youth. “Not only did our foundation benefit but there was some great poker played as well,” Taylor said. “I’m not just saying that because I finished in third place (last year).”

The charity event has $300 buy-in with unlimited re-entries and kicks off Wednesday night, March 29th at 7 pm. There is a seat to $3,500 SHRPO, a four-day, three-night Hard Rock Resort vacation package in Cancun and even a Jason Taylor golf outing added to prize pool.

The SHR poker room is running three to four mega satellites a day for virtually every event, with a 9 am event for early risers.
